Transaction 67d07521f77379c71fcd970f24b35e3a3282f1ac5009ce70c4e2f889d1117d0e
1 Input
2 Outputs
- 67d07521f77379c71fcd970f24b35e3a3282f1ac5009ce70c4e2f889d1117d0e:0
- 67d07521f77379c71fcd970f24b35e3a3282f1ac5009ce70c4e2f889d1117d0e:1
value 6492039
address 3AM8KT8LxsL8J7TUNVC1QDhdZrCHx9wwEs
value 22213540
address 17nmPnTFmyPWrrrWBY1EYKeV4B8ZJk1s9z